**Ticket 4412 — Pick-list optimizer skips cold-zone bins**

The Harbinger optimizer at Dellwood Fulfilment intermittently omits bins in the cold zone, producing incomplete pick lists during overnight waves. Reproduced twice on staging; suspect a stale zone-weight cache. Please hold the release until triaged. The failing environment reports the build shown below.

pipeline stamp: htk6_35e0c9

## Deep-Link Routing Setup

Welcome to the Fernwick mobile repo! Deep links are handled by the Lanternpath router, which maps inbound URIs to screens via the manifest in routes/links.yaml. When reviewing PRs, check that every new route has a fallback screen — otherwise Android users get a blank view. To test routing locally, you'll run the link-simulator, which needs to sign its fake intents against staging. Drop this line into your .env.local before firing it up:

secret setting of hawep-yahig: LEDGER_TOKEN29=41b5d6315371c92885eaeb077fb63

Subject: Relevance tuning cut-over — done

Hey, quick heads-up for on-call: we cut over the new search relevance profile on Lanternfish tonight. Synonym boosts and the recency decay from last week's tuning notes are now live. If result quality tanks, flip back to the previous profile — it's still deployed. The active ranking service reads the settings shown below.

config for kajog-tadug:
[casax]
port = 11211
region = west-3
host = casax.nelvroworks.internal
timeout_ms = 5000
retries = 7

Subject: Handover — Quillforge render pipeline

Hi Tama,

Welcome aboard! I'm rotating off release duty for the Quillforge markdown pipeline, so here's the short version. Builds kick off nightly; the renderer artifacts go to the staging bucket, and promotion to prod needs a signed manifest. Dalia handles the changelog, you handle tagging. Watch the table-of-contents job — it flakes on Mondays for reasons nobody has diagnosed. For promoting releases you'll need the deploy key, pasted here for convenience.

signing key of bagap-yawep = bky13_TbfT6ZMUoGJo2